摘要:
Monte Carlo Methods are described for use in the calibration and optimum design of radiation gauges and analyzers. The advantages of the use of specific Monte Carlo models designed for a particular gauge or analyzer are discussed relative to the use of existing general purpose Monte Carlo codes. The extensive use of variance reduction techniques based on fundamental physical principles and properties of the particular system of interest is stressed in the design of these Monte Carlo models.
